Different Types of Dolls for Dollhouse

Dolls for dollhouse come in many forms, each designed to fit different styles of play or display. The choice of doll often depends on the scale of the dollhouse and the level of detail desired.

Wooden Dolls

Wooden dolls are popular for younger children due to their durability and simple design. These dolls usually have basic features and movable parts, making them easy to handle. Their minimalist appearance allows children to use their imagination freely, without being limited by highly detailed facial expressions.

Plastic and Vinyl Dolls

Plastic and vinyl dolls are commonly found in modern dollhouse sets. They often have more defined facial features and flexible limbs, which make posing easier. These dolls are suitable for interactive play and are available in a wide range of styles, from realistic families to fantasy characters.

Porcelain and Resin Dolls

For collectors, porcelain and resin dolls offer a higher level of detail and craftsmanship. These dolls are usually intended for display rather than play. They often feature hand-painted faces, carefully designed clothing, and realistic proportions that enhance the visual appeal of a dollhouse.

Understanding Dollhouse Scales

Choosing the right dolls for dollhouse use requires an understanding of scale. Scale refers to the size ratio between the dollhouse and real-life objects. Using the correct scale ensures that dolls look natural within the miniature environment.

Common Dollhouse Scales

  • 112 scale, also known as one-inch scale
  • 124 scale for smaller dollhouses
  • 16 scale for larger, fashion-style dolls
  • 118 scale for compact playsets

Matching dolls to the correct scale improves realism and prevents visual imbalance. A doll that is too large or too small can disrupt the overall appearance of the dollhouse.

Dolls for Dollhouse Collectors

While dollhouse dolls are often associated with children, many adults enjoy collecting them as a hobby. Collectors may focus on specific styles, historical eras, or artisan-made dolls. For them, dolls represent craftsmanship, nostalgia, and artistic expression.

Display and Preservation

Collectors usually display dolls carefully to protect them from damage. Proper storage, controlled lighting, and gentle handling help preserve delicate materials like fabric, porcelain, or resin. A well-curated dollhouse with matching dolls can become a centerpiece of a collection.
